如何进行iBATIS SQLMap API编程的浅析

发布时间:2021-12-18 21:51:32 作者:柒染
来源:亿速云 阅读:339

如何进行iBATIS SQLMap API编程的浅析,很多新手对此不是很清楚,为了帮助大家解决这个难题,下面小编将为大家详细讲解,有这方面需求的人可以来学习下,希望你能有所收获。

首先我们配置好sqlmap-config.xml文件以后,需要对他进行解析,例如:

iBATIS SQLMap的Java代码

public void insert(Person p){         String xml = "com/Jdnis/ibatis/map/sql-map-config.xml";         SqlMapClient sqlMap = null;         try {             Reader reader = Resources.getResourceAsReader(xml);             sqlMap = SqlMapClientBuilder.buildSqlMapClient(reader);             sqlMap.startTransaction();             sqlMap.insert("insertPerson",p);             sqlMap.commitTransaction();             System.out.println("数据插入成功");         } catch (IOException e) {             // TODO Auto-generated catch block             e.printStackTrace();         } catch (SQLException e) {             // TODO Auto-generated catch block             System.out.println("主键 "+p.getId()+" 冲突!无法插入数据");         }finally{             try {                 sqlMap.endTransaction();             } catch (SQLException e) {                 // TODO Auto-generated catch block                 e.printStackTrace();             }         }     }

iBATIS SQLMap API编程批处理:

Java代码

sqlMap.startBatch();     //...execute statements in between     sqlMap.executeBatch();

看完上述内容是否对您有帮助呢?如果还想对相关知识有进一步的了解或阅读更多相关文章,请关注亿速云行业资讯频道,感谢您对亿速云的支持。

推荐阅读:
  1. Java项目怎么利用ibatis进行搭建
  2. 如何通过ibatis操作mysql

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

ibatis sqlmap api

上一篇:XML序列化的优缺点是什么

下一篇:如何进行springboot配置templates直接访问的实现

相关阅读

您好,登录后才能下订单哦!

密码登录
登录注册
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》